3–Adapter Management Applications
Linux Management Applications
110 CU0354602-00 L
QConvergeConsole CLI-based diagnostics include the following commands:
To enable or disable the port beacon,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ic -beacon [cna_port_inst] <on|off>
To run an internal loopback test,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ic -intloopback <cna_port_inst> <tests_num> <on_error>
where tests_num is the number of tests (1–65535) and on_error is either
0=Ignore or 1=Abort
To perform a Flash test,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ic testflash [cna_port_inst]
To perform a hardware test,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ic -testhw [cna_port_inst]
To perform an interrupt test,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ic -testinterrupt [cna_port_inst]
To perform a link test,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ic -testlink [cna_port_inst]
To perform a register test,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ic -testregister [cna_port_inst]
To display transceiver DMI data, issue the following command:
qaucli -pr nic -trans [cna_port_inst]
Ethtool Diagnostics
To perform an adapter self-test using ethtool-based diagnostics, issue the
following command:
# ethtool -t eth<x> offline
The self-test includes the following:
Loopback test
Interrupt test
Link test
Register test
Examples:
# ethtool -t eth8 offline
The test result is PASS
The test extra info:
Register_Test_on_offline 0
Link_Test_on_offline 0
Interrupt_Test_offline 0
Loopback_Test_offline 0
